I've been thinking about a lot of simulators lately, and in particular AHIII and how the game actually works.  I go back to the Fighter Squadron: The Screamin' Demons Over Europe game that was out from a company just was a short drive from HTC actually - they basically created a simulated environment with earth physics of air and gravity and all objects had data that entered into this. 

All the aircraft had a individual data file that included weight, COG, drag coefficient (that changed with structural damage), engine HP and torque, structural speed limit (go too fast and you start damaging wings and stabilizer surfaces) - but the data was there for all to see. AWESOME sim for the time.

And I think that Microsoft sims are pretty much the same way - yet somehow they seem to forget about environmental physics as most planes in MSFS X fly on rails.

So, how is Aces High done? Environment and then depending on the weight assigned, drag coefficient, engine power, and other data assigned to the model, then determines how the model interacts with the airplane? Same for vehicles and ships?

Aces High calculates the physics of flight in real time based on your aircraft characteristics, altitude, and loadout.

I don't know what the other sims do but I think MSFS uses a basic flight model with a look up table for speed, turn rate, climb rate etc.

I believe the reason "nose bounce" is a frequent complaint when players come from other sims is due to the difference in flight fidelity.

We divide the plane into many small airfoils as an  example each wing is divided into 32 sections. But we consider all components of the plane to be airfoils including the fuse. 

Then modify the needed sectional air foils for control inputs.

We then calculate AOA's and wind velocities for all sections and then do some fancy math to come up with force and direction for each section.

Add in a few other forces like gyroscopic and thrust (how much thrust and where is not a very simple computation)  and gravity.

Sum them all up, and use the simple force = mass * acceleration. Walla the plane flys

The data we input for all this is not simply a  lift and drag coefficient.

I figured as much as the aircraft bounces around like it does in real life if you happen to mash the controller - the aircraft doesn't react as a single entity like Microsoft flight Sim, but a collection of it's parts, hence the 'bouncy' effects you sometimes get especially if you cross wind barriers.

So what you're saying, you've modeled the environment to act on the surfaces on the aircraft as it would in real life. That way all you have to do is model the aircraft and the environmental coding takes care of the rest.  Neat!  Thanks for the info!
